Output 673616e05aeb3ec811b82db890bcf0ed42a0ca7e0b44fa3e78ccc33760ba1625:0

value
213050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23417d68359ed3c6af5c5144d9eac1bf8d1e3c81 OP_EQUAL
address
MB7aLTefDKtm2FNZpNTkLbkon5kKzX39iT
transaction
673616e05aeb3ec811b82db890bcf0ed42a0ca7e0b44fa3e78ccc33760ba1625
spent
true